Output cfcdfdcc2cbbdde33358df418bedb66aff68b92993dc16155b63113b9ea46f45:23

value
175404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1df52111a69511284189e9f1e9eb508610ca78f0 OP_EQUAL
address
34RRAypoZ5L5nsmFL3bRAFhAB6wbUmfdof
transaction
cfcdfdcc2cbbdde33358df418bedb66aff68b92993dc16155b63113b9ea46f45
confirmations
185327
spent
true